[Compbench-devel] CompBenchmarks++/Benchmark Benchmark.cpp, 1.21, 1.22 Benchmark.h, 1.17, 1.18
Brought to you by:
xfred
From: Frederic T. <xf...@us...> - 2007-01-21 21:27:24
|
Update of /cvsroot/compbench/CompBenchmarks++/Benchmark In directory sc8-pr-cvs4.sourceforge.net:/tmp/cvs-serv2505 Modified Files: Benchmark.cpp Benchmark.h Log Message: API changes on CBM::Benchmark Index: Benchmark.h =================================================================== RCS file: /cvsroot/compbench/CompBenchmarks++/Benchmark/Benchmark.h,v retrieving revision 1.17 retrieving revision 1.18 diff -C2 -d -r1.17 -r1.18 *** Benchmark.h 18 Jan 2007 18:44:01 -0000 1.17 --- Benchmark.h 21 Jan 2007 21:27:21 -0000 1.18 *************** *** 57,65 **** \return a std::string representing current benchmark's identification (e.g. gzip-1c) */ ! virtual std::string benchmarkName(void) = 0; /** Benchmark comments \return a std::string containing comments about current benchmark */ ! virtual std::string benchmarkComments(void) = 0; /** Run benchmark. --- 57,65 ---- \return a std::string representing current benchmark's identification (e.g. gzip-1c) */ ! virtual std::string Name(void) = 0; /** Benchmark comments \return a std::string containing comments about current benchmark */ ! virtual std::string Comments(void) = 0; /** Run benchmark. Index: Benchmark.cpp =================================================================== RCS file: /cvsroot/compbench/CompBenchmarks++/Benchmark/Benchmark.cpp,v retrieving revision 1.21 retrieving revision 1.22 diff -C2 -d -r1.21 -r1.22 *** Benchmark.cpp 21 Jan 2007 21:16:01 -0000 1.21 --- Benchmark.cpp 21 Jan 2007 21:27:21 -0000 1.22 *************** *** 15,24 **** void Benchmark::display(void) { ! std::cout << "benchmark::Name=" << benchmarkName() << std::endl << "benchmark::Package=" << Package()->Name() << std::endl << "benchmark::Language=" << Package()->language() << std::endl << "benchmark::Size=" << Package()->totalSize() << std::endl << "benchmark::Status=" << Package()->getStatus() << std::endl ! << "benchmark::Comments=" << benchmarkComments() << std::endl << std::endl; } --- 15,24 ---- void Benchmark::display(void) { ! std::cout << "benchmark::Name=" << Name() << std::endl << "benchmark::Package=" << Package()->Name() << std::endl << "benchmark::Language=" << Package()->language() << std::endl << "benchmark::Size=" << Package()->totalSize() << std::endl << "benchmark::Status=" << Package()->getStatus() << std::endl ! << "benchmark::Comments=" << Comments() << std::endl << std::endl; } *************** *** 45,49 **** if (((Package()->getStatus()<Package::Tested) && (Package()->hasTest())) && (UO_enableTestSuite)) { ! info=benchmarkName(); info+=" not tested !"; cbmUI->Information(CBM::UI::BenchTest, --- 45,49 ---- if (((Package()->getStatus()<Package::Tested) && (Package()->hasTest())) && (UO_enableTestSuite)) { ! info=Name(); info+=" not tested !"; cbmUI->Information(CBM::UI::BenchTest, *************** *** 54,58 **** cbmUI->Information(CBM::UI::BenchBench, ! benchmarkName()); r=bench(); --- 54,58 ---- cbmUI->Information(CBM::UI::BenchBench, ! Name()); r=bench(); *************** *** 62,66 **** Package()->storeStatus(Package::Benchmarked); cbmUI->Information(CBM::UI::BenchResult, ! r); } else { info="Benchmarking failed for "; --- 62,66 ---- Package()->storeStatus(Package::Benchmarked); cbmUI->Information(CBM::UI::BenchResult, ! r); } else { info="Benchmarking failed for "; |